It would >seem to me that if we want a word for (in this case) the capital of >the Republic of China, we want something that instead means "x such >that x is Beijing", *NOT* "x such that I am calling x 'beidjin'". If >this is right, then Lojban Central should be seeking fuhivla, not >cmene, for the various states of the USA, etc. Naming is speaker-referent, not absolute. I'm sure the Native Americans had a name for the swamp we later called Washington, D.C., and in some point in the future, it may be called the Place-that-Was or some such by the pos-nuclear-holocaust inhabitants of the area. (see the short story "By the Waters of Babylon") Even now, some Americans have names for the place that are not really suitable for a public forum. I just wish we could have content-bearing cmene. I'd love to see a lojbanic cmene for the Snake River that non-accidentally had the "snakey-shaped river" lujvo in it. Makes translating, or creating, some naming traditions easier.
